Hornets sign Hungarian

Watford have signed Hungary striker Tamas Priskin.

Priskin has joined from Gyori ETO for an undisclosed fee having agreed a four-year deal.

The 20-year-old is Aidy Boothroyd’s fourth senior signing of the summer following a trial as the Hornets prepare for life in the Barclays Premiership.

Priskin told the club’s website watfordfc.co.uk: “Everyone knows that the Premier League is the best league to play your football in and there’s nowhere better than Watford for me to continue my development as a player. I’m really excited by the challenge.”

Priskin has three caps for the Hungarian national team.
